Has an NCAA Women's Basketball game ever ended 95-90?

Yes. NCAA Women's Basketball has seen a final score of 95-90 9 times. It first happened on February 1, 2007, when Nicholls Colonels beat Lamar Cardinals, and most recently on January 1, 2026, when Georgia Tech Yellow Jackets beat Notre Dame Fighting Irish.
